CELENTANO BIOTECH HEALTH AND MEDICAL MAGNET SCHOOL
Celentano BioTech Health and Medical Magnet School is a Title I public elementary school that is part of the New Haven School District school district, located in New Haven, CT with about 376 students offering grade levels from Pre-Kindergarten to 8th Grade. A Title I school prov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families. Its purpose is to provide all children significant opportunity to receive a fair, equitable, and high-quality education. With about 33 teachers, Celentano BioTech Health and Medical Magnet School has a student/teacher ratio of about 11:1. The national average for public schools is about 15:1. A lower student/teacher ratio is a key factor that determines how much a teacher can devote his/her time to each individual student thus improving, or reducing (in the event of a higher student/teacher ratio) the attention each student is given for their educational needs.
Celentano BioTech, Health, and Medical Magnet School, located in the East Rock neighborhood of New Haven, Connecticut, is a specialized K-8 public school within the New Haven Public Schools district. The school is defined by its rigorous academic focus on ST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ics), with a specific emphasis on the biological and health sciences. By integrating medical and biotech themes into the standard curriculum, Celentano aims to prepare students for future careers in healthcare and research while fostering critical thinking and scientific literacy from an early age.
Beyond its academic curriculum, the school is recognized for its commitment to hands-on, experiential learning and community partnerships. As a magnet school, it draws a diverse student body from across the New Haven area, offering unique enrichment opportunities, state-of-the-art laboratory experiences, and extracurricular programs that align with its medical theme. The school’s mission centers on providing a supportive environment that emphasizes academic excellence and prepares students to meet the demands of a modern, technology-driven society.
